Job Details
Description
As the Training Manager you will manage a team of trainers to deliver an effective, efficient and evolving service to the business including everything training related from new starter induction to succession planning. The training strategy and budget will be your responsibility. You will sit on the senior management team for the large site in Leeds and be expected to report meaningful KPIs to the Board on a regular basis.
Profile
The successful Training Manager will have:
* worked in a similar strategic training position with responsibility for a team - ESSENTIAL
* strong leadership qualities and demonstrate consistent behaviours - ESSENTIAL
* previously worked in a distribution or manufacturing training role - ESSENTIAL
* strong written and verbal communication skills - ESSENTIAL
* completed CIPD or hold an equivalent training qualification - DESIRABLE
Job Offer
This is a permanent opportunity to work for an International business based in South Leeds paying up to £45,000 plus benefits.
